Output fa2cb59cc49399e6d5fd205bde80d3d09111b2e119ae7076a42ed91670db2b84:1

value
6115681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b2693166445adb4b32644638017fe4ad3223894 OP_EQUAL
address
3QayjuBzDiyNxrNtKu4h4p4n8JNnUkYQL6
transaction
fa2cb59cc49399e6d5fd205bde80d3d09111b2e119ae7076a42ed91670db2b84
confirmations
154265
spent
true